Dev

GitHub Trending: OpenMetadata Revolutionizes Metadata Management

OpenMetadata, an open-source metadata management platform, is gaining attention in the developer community for integrating discovery, quality control, and governance.

4 min read

GitHub Trending: OpenMetadata Revolutionizes Metadata Management
Photo by Markus Winkler on Unsplash

On April 22, 2026, a new project captured the spotlight on GitHub Trending, a key indicator of developer community trends: “OpenMetadata.” Hosted at open-metadata/OpenMetadata, this open-source metadata management platform aims to help companies effectively manage and utilize their data assets. While still in its early stages, it is clear that this project has piqued the interest of developers worldwide.

What is OpenMetadata? Not Just a Catalogue, But an Integrated Framework

OpenMetadata is much more than a simple data catalog or documentation tool. As its name suggests, it focuses on metadata—data about data—which includes the structure, meaning, relationships, quality, and access permissions of data, all managed in a centralized platform. While traditional tools act as “maps” to show where data resides, OpenMetadata goes further by acting as a “city planning blueprint” that manages what data is, how it is used, and who is responsible for it.

The rise of OpenMetadata on GitHub Trending reflects the “data chaos” prevalent in modern business environments. With the coexistence of cloud services, SaaS, and on-premises systems, data is dispersed across organizations, making it increasingly difficult to track its location or assess its quality. Data engineers and analysts often spend excessive time merely searching for data, while issues related to data reliability persist. OpenMetadata was developed as a comprehensive solution to address these challenges.

Technical Features: Fusion of Cloud-Native Design and Automation

OpenMetadata stands out due to its cloud-native architecture and automation capabilities. First and foremost, it enables easy deployment through Kubernetes and Docker containers. It integrates seamlessly with cloud environments like AWS, GCP, and Azure, ensuring scalability and flexibility.

Its most notable feature is the automatic collection and integration of metadata. OpenMetadata connects with data warehouses like Snowflake, BigQuery, and Redshift; relational databases like PostgreSQL and MySQL; and streaming platforms like Kafka and Spark to automatically extract schemas and track changes. This drastically reduces the manual effort required for documentation and updates.

Additionally, OpenMetadata has built-in “data profiling” and “quality check” functionalities. It automatically analyzes aspects like the proportion of NULL values, uniqueness, and value distributions to detect quality issues early. For instance, if anomalies are detected in sales data, OpenMetadata can issue an alert and notify data engineers. This level of automation is revolutionary for ensuring data reliability.

Impact on Industries: Redefining Data Governance and DevOps

The emergence of OpenMetadata is not merely the introduction of a new tool; it profoundly influences corporate data governance strategies and DevOps cultures.

First, it democratizes data governance. Traditionally, metadata management was a project led by data engineers and specialists. However, OpenMetadata’s intuitive UI and API-driven approach allow analysts, scientists, and even business users to view and contribute to metadata. This enhances “data literacy,” thereby elevating the organization’s overall ability to leverage data.

Second, it promotes the convergence of DevOps and DataOps. OpenMetadata integrates with CI/CD pipelines and automatically tracks the impact of data pipeline changes on metadata. For example, it can simulate how schema changes in Spark jobs would affect dashboard displays. This enables faster development cycles while ensuring data quality.

From a security and compliance perspective, OpenMetadata is particularly significant. It supports regulations like GDPR and CCPA by facilitating centralized management of data classification, access logs, and privacy tagging, thereby streamlining audit processes. This feature is especially valuable for highly regulated industries such as finance and healthcare.

Developer Community Reaction and Future Outlook

The appearance of OpenMetadata on GitHub Trending signals its rapid adoption within the developer community. As an open-source project, it is benefiting from contributions from developers worldwide, fostering ecosystem growth. Its ease of plugin development and compatibility with existing toolchains are highly praised.

Looking ahead, integration with AI is highly anticipated. Since OpenMetadata stores metadata in a structured format, it can be leveraged as training data for natural language processing (NLP) and machine learning models. For example, in the future, users might ask, “Analyze trends in sales data,” and OpenMetadata could automatically identify relevant tables and columns to generate an analysis pipeline.

Expansion into edge computing and IoT environments is also expected. As the need to manage metadata from vast numbers of edge devices grows, OpenMetadata’s scalable architecture will play a key role in ensuring real-time data quality.

Conclusion: Ushering in a New Era of Metadata Management

OpenMetadata’s entry into GitHub Trending is a sign of its transformative impact on the field of metadata management. Far from being just another tool, it serves as a foundational platform for building data-driven organizations. Developers and businesses should take note and consider how to incorporate this open-source project into their data strategies. In an era where data is often referred to as “the new oil,” OpenMetadata may hold the key to unlocking its true value.


Frequently Asked Questions

Is OpenMetadata free to use?
Yes, OpenMetadata is an open-source project, and its basic features are free to use. However, there might be paid plans offering enterprise-level commercial support or additional features. Please refer to the official GitHub repository for more details.
How does OpenMetadata differ from other metadata management tools like Apache Atlas or DataHub?
OpenMetadata stands out with its cloud-native design and integrated UI. It offers automatic metadata collection, data quality checks, and governance functionalities in a single platform, making it both user-friendly and comprehensive. Additionally, it benefits from active development within the open-source community.
What technical resources are required to implement OpenMetadata?
A Kubernetes environment and an SQL database (e.g., PostgreSQL) are essential. Deployment is straightforward on cloud providers and can also be tested locally using Docker Compose. Teams with knowledge of metadata management and integrated data sources will find implementation easier.
Source: GitHub Trending

Comments

← Back to Home